Subtract 56/14 from 10/45
1st number: 10/45, 2nd number: 4 0/14
10/45 - 56/14 is -34/9.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 45 and 14 is 630
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 630 - For the 1st fraction, since 45 × 14 = 630,
10/45 = 10 × 14/45 × 14 = 140/630 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 14 × 45 = 630,
56/14 = 56 × 45/14 × 45 = 2520/630 - Subtract the two like fractions:
140/630 - 2520/630 = 140 - 2520/630 = -2380/630 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-34/9
